WHY ARE THESE SO HYPED UP?
UV glow in the dark Halloween contact lenses are something which will make you the talk of social media, they are completely out of the box. Normal contact lenses stay the same throughout the day, whereas UV contact lenses glow (as it gets so obvious by its name) and they are designed in a way that they turn neon when exposed to a black light and can be seen from far away, making them perfect for raves, blacklight parties, and Halloween events. PRECAUTIONS
Although these glow in the dark contact lenses look cook but and pull off any look, safety always comes first and you should be aware of the precautions that would help you to rock every party. These lenses are 100% safe to wear as they reportedly haven’t caused any harm due to the backlight effect and won’t irritate your eyes at all but you should always get them through a reliable source(legally approved and reputable online sellers) who provides good quality lenses are you can’t take risk with your eyes. The precautions for these are the same as the regular contact lenses as everything is the same just an added usp.
- Here are a few important tips that might be helpful.
- wash your hands and sanitize them before touching your eyes or the lens.
- clean your lenses with an all-purpose contact solution.
- store them in a contact lens case as proper storage is very important or else it can cause an infection.
- never reuse saline solution.
- never use saliva to rinse your contacts.
- never keep lenses longer than recommended (they need to be replaced)
- never sleep in your lenses.
- apply these lenses before applying makeup.
- if any redness, irritation or pain occurs, consult an eye specialist immediately.
*NOTE: never share your lenses with anyone. It’s a big NO! Not even your close family member thinking that you can save money or maybe if they want to try to see if the colour suits them or not. Doing this can spread harmful infections which can cause serious problems for your eyes.
